South Hamilton Volleyball Pulls Comeback to Stun Madrid, 3-2

The South Hamilton Hawks volleyball team returned to action on Thursday night, when they made the drive south on Highway 17 to take on the Madrid Tigers in non-conference action at Madrid High School. The Hawks entered with a record of 3-8, while Madrid entered at 1-1.

Things started off sluggishly for the Hawks, as mistakes snowballed in the first two sets, as South Hamilton fell behind 2-0 with sets of 15-25 and 20-25. The tides then began to turn in the 3rd set, when the Hawks got a spark from senior Grace Neuberger, as they took set 3 by a score of 25-20. Things continued to trend for South Hamilton when they managed to hold off a late Madrid rally in set 4 to win 25-22 and send it into a 5th set. The Hawks managed to take control late in the frame, and take home a 15-11 win and complete the comeback for a 3-2 win.

Grace Neuberger was the Jewell Market Player of the Game, unofficially tallying 6 kills and 3 aces on the night for the Hawks. South Hamilton returns to action on Saturday, as they’re scheduled to compete at the South Central Calhoun Tournament in Lake City.
